Distance and time SANORD

Great-circle distance SAN–ORD is about 1,720 miles. Block time on a nonstop is typically near 4 hours; wind, routing, and which runway you use still move the clock. Connections on the same city pair add layover time on top of that flying.

Chicago is about 2 hours ahead of San Diego on standard time (America/Los_Angeles vs America/Chicago). Arrival clocks on ORD are local. That matters more on this pair than on a same-zone hop.

When SAN–ORD has a nonstop, that is usually the cleanest product. One-stop options still appear — they are worth opening only if the USD total is materially lower after you count the extra ground time.

Airports for San Diego to Chicago

Both ends are in the United States: San Diego International (SAN) to O'Hare International (ORD). This is not an international itinerary, so the usual domestic bag and ID rules apply at the seller. Alternate metro airports can still beat this pair on price.

SAN is the only origin code we list in this metro. On arrival, MDW (Chicago) can price differently from ORD. A cheaper nearby airport only wins if the transfer still fits your plan. Search with “include nearby airports” when you want those codes in one results list.

Bags on SANORD

US domestic San Diego–Chicago inventory often includes basic economy. Cabin and checked bags may be extra — the result cards say so when we have that fact. A cheaper headline fare can lose once you add a carry-on.

When people fly

On San Diego–Chicago, demand is often softer in Jan and Feb, with Sep and Oct also worth checking. US holidays still reprice this pair. Move a day on the results strip before you assume the first date you typed is the cheapest.
